Death date taken from probate record. Cannot read date of birth on stone, but I can make out the 1828, which coincides with census records. There are some records listing him as James, which could possibly be a mistranscription of Jerry in hard to read writing. There are many more records that refer to him as Jeremiah than as James. I have only found him listed as James on the 1870 census and parts of his probate record (other parts have him as Jeremiah). However, in land records between he and his oldest son John, who was the eventual administrator of his estate, he is listed as Jeremiah. Also, in a federal land record, his son Jerry Mirah is listed as Jeremiah, Jr. I am still researching this family and welcome all comments/information.

His first wife was Nancy Rawls, born 1829 in Georgia. They married 9/17/1850 in Marion County, GA. He married secondly on 10/15/1861 in Bienville Parish to Laurella Stevenson Alden Fuller, the daughter of Benjamin Franklin Stevenson and Elizabeth Willis. This was her 3rd marriage. After she died, he married thirdly on 2/10/1871 in Bienville Parish to Arminta Brackin, a widow whose maiden name is not known at this time.

According to Biographical and Historical Memoirs of Northwest Louisiana, The Southern Publishing Company, Chicago & Nashville, 1890, Jeremiah was listed in a parish record of citizens the parish sent to the civil war. Most probably in the "Old Home Guard".
